I noticed one thing concerning tags:

I was making use of a tag for a business trip and just couldn't figure out why 
the figures wouldn't add up as expected.

Finally I realized that the error was this:

      - Assume you have a transaction T1 with a certain tag in account A.
      - That transaction T1 transfers the money to account B.
      - On account B there is another transaction T2 which compensates for T1.
      - In account B transaction T1 is actually seen as a T1', since the tag 
present in T1 is not assigned here anymore.

=> When I now sum up everything T1' is missing.


So, I guess, what the code should/could do - by default - is to assign the tag 
to both transactions, the outgoing in A as well as the incoming in B.

At this time only on the first account of the transaction is added the tag/tags. This work well in a normal deposit/withdrawal as the first account is a category not a real user account but maybe not so well with a transfer between two accounts.

I'm reposting this in the mailing list so that others can give some suggestions.

Should we add the tag/tags to each transaction (a transaction in the engine is composed of at least two transaction, one that operate on a category or account and the other that operate on an account)?

Or should we do this only for transfer transactions?
